会编程和程序员有什么区别
-
编程和程序员是密切相关的两个概念,但它们并不完全相同。编程是指使用编程语言来编写代码,实现特定功能的过程。而程序员则是指从事编程工作的人员。
首先,从定义上来说,编程是一种技术活动,它涉及到使用编程语言来编写代码,实现特定的功能。编程需要程序员具备一定的技术和知识,包括掌握编程语言、算法和数据结构等。编程是一种创造性的过程,它需要程序员根据需求设计程序的逻辑、编写代码,并进行调试和优化,最终实现预期的功能。
而程序员则是从事编程工作的人员。程序员是编程的实施者,他们负责根据需求分析设计程序的逻辑,编写代码,并进行调试和优化。程序员需要具备良好的编程技术和解决问题的能力,能够根据需求设计合理的程序架构,并有效地编写高质量的代码。程序员还需要不断学习和更新自己的知识,以适应快速发展的技术和需求变化。
从角色上来说,编程是一种技术活动,可以由任何具备编程知识和技术的人来进行。而程序员则是专门从事编程工作的人员,他们通常在软件开发或IT行业中从事编程相关的工作。程序员往往需要具备更深入的编程技术和经验,能够独立完成复杂的编程任务,并与团队协作进行软件开发。
此外,编程和程序员还存在一些其他的区别。编程是一种技术活动,它强调的是实现特定功能的过程,而程序员则强调的是从事编程工作的人员。编程可以是一种临时的活动,也可以是一种长期的职业,而程序员则是从事编程工作的专业人士。
综上所述,编程和程序员是密切相关但不完全相同的概念。编程是一种技术活动,指的是使用编程语言来编写代码实现特定功能的过程;而程序员则是从事编程工作的人员,他们负责根据需求设计程序的逻辑,编写代码,并进行调试和优化。编程是一种技术活动,可以由任何具备编程知识和技术的人来进行,而程序员则是专门从事编程工作的人员。
1年前 -
编程和程序员是密不可分的概念,但它们并不完全相同。下面是编程和程序员的区别:
-
定义:编程是一种创造性的过程,通过编写一系列的指令来指导计算机执行特定的任务。它是将问题分解为一系列的步骤,并使用编程语言来描述这些步骤的过程。而程序员是具有编程技能和知识的人,能够使用编程语言来创建和开发软件应用程序。
-
范围:编程是一个广泛的概念,涵盖了从简单的脚本编写到复杂的应用程序开发等各个层面。它可以应用于多个领域,如软件开发、网站设计、数据分析等。而程序员是在特定领域或特定项目中进行编程工作的人。
-
技能要求:编程需要一定的技术和逻辑思维能力。它需要掌握编程语言的语法和语义,并理解算法和数据结构的基本概念。程序员除了具备编程技能外,还需要具备问题解决能力、团队合作能力和项目管理能力等。
-
职责:编程的主要职责是将问题抽象化,并将其转化为可执行的代码。编程需要不断地进行调试和测试,以确保代码的正确性和可靠性。而程序员的职责是根据需求分析和设计规范来编写代码,并进行软件开发和维护工作。
-
发展方向:编程是一项技能,可以通过学习和实践不断提高。学习编程可以使人们更好地理解计算机系统和技术,并为未来的职业发展打下基础。而程序员可以根据个人的兴趣和专长选择不同的领域和技术方向进行深入研究和发展。
总结起来,编程是一种创造性的过程,是将问题分解为一系列步骤,并使用编程语言来描述这些步骤的过程。而程序员是具备编程技能和知识的人,能够使用编程语言来创建和开发软件应用程序。编程是程序员的核心技能,程序员通过编程来实现软件开发和维护工作。
1年前 -
-
编程和程序员是两个不同的概念。编程是指使用计算机语言编写代码的过程,而程序员是指从事编程工作的人。
编程是一种技能或技术,它涉及到使用特定的计算机语言,如C++、Python、Java等,编写一系列的指令来实现特定的功能。编程可以用于开发各种应用程序、网站、游戏等。编程的核心是解决问题和实现功能,它需要思维的逻辑性和创造性。
程序员是指具有编程技能的人,他们可以根据需求和规范来编写代码。程序员通常具有计算机科学或相关领域的学位或培训,并具有一定的编程经验和技能。他们能够理解需求,设计和实现代码,进行调试和测试,以及维护和优化现有的代码。
虽然编程和程序员有密切的联系,但它们并不完全相同。编程是一种技术,而程序员是应用这种技术的人。编程是实现功能的方法,而程序员是使用这种方法的专业人员。一个人可以学会编程,但不一定是程序员;而一个人可以是程序员,但不一定要精通所有的编程语言和技术。
总的来说,编程是一种技术,它涉及到使用计算机语言编写代码;程序员是从事编程工作的人,他们具有编程技能和经验,能够根据需求和规范来编写代码。
1年前